The Bellwood-Antis community is invited to come out this Friday to enjoy a fun-filled day with fireworks, a chicken barbecue, hometown raffle, games, golf tournament, bingo, a Star Search competition and much more.
The 86th Annual Bellwood-Antis Community Picnic and All-Class reunion will be held this Friday at DelGrosso’s Amusement Park.
All Bellwood-Antis School District students in grades pre-school through 2005 graduates may stop by to get free passes, good for all-day waterworks, rapids and ride passes.
The passes are also available for school age children of graduates who have registered for the all-class reunion. Free ride pass bracelets may be picked up at the red and white tent between 10:30 a.m. to 7 p.m.
Activities begin with the 14th Annual Bellwood-Antis Championship Golf Tournament. This event is open to youths grades Kindergarten through 12th grade. There will be prizes awarded. Registration begins at 10 a.m.
At 11:30 an adult golf tournament will be held.
Children’s games begin at 2 p.m. and the Bellwood-Antis Lions will host free bingo from 3-5 p.m.
The Farm Show chicken barbecue will begin at 5 p.m. and the 12th Annual Bellwood-Antis Star Search, sponsored by First Commonwealth Bank and the Bellwood-Antis Lions Club will begin at 5:30.
To participate, individuals must register by tomorrow. Call Bob or Barb at Star Search Headquarters at 742-8706.
Divisions for the competition are preschool through fourth grade; fifth through eighth grade; ninth through 12th grade; adults ­– up to 40-years-old; adults – 40-years-old and over and groups of three or more individuals.
Prizes will be awarded for each division. First place winners will receive $100, second place will receive $80, $60 will be given for third place, $40 for fourth place and $20 for fifth place finishers.
The Hometown raffle drawing will be held at the conclusion of the Star Search competition. The raffle is a chance to win homemade items from artisans of the Bellwood and Antis Township communities.
Finally, at 10 p.m. everyone can enjoy a fireworks display to end the evening.
